電子發(fā)燒友App

硬聲App

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示
創(chuàng)作
電子發(fā)燒友網(wǎng)>電子資料下載>電子資料>使用Tinkercad在Arduino上玩霸王龍恐龍游戲

使用Tinkercad在Arduino上玩霸王龍恐龍游戲

2022-10-28 | zip | 0.04 MB | 次下載 | 免費

資料介紹

描述

在這個項目中,我們將看到如何在沒有可用 Internet 連接的情況下制作我們在 Google Chrome 上都喜歡的著名的 Running T-Rex Dinosaur 游戲。

補給品

硬件組件:

Arduino UNO

16x2 液晶

1K歐姆電阻

2 個按鈕

一些電線

第 1 步:電路連接:

我們使用 4 個數(shù)據(jù)引腳和控制引腳 R/W、E 和 RSArduino UNO 連接到 LCD。

我們將 LCD 電源引腳 VCC 和 GND 連接到 Arduino 5V 和 GND。

對比 V0 引腳連接到 GND。

背光 LED +ve 連接到 5v,-ve 通過 1K 歐姆電阻連接到 GND。

我們使用按鈕來控制游戲。

第 2 步:Arduino 代碼

在這里,我們首先包含 LCD 庫和 LCD 定義以及恐龍角色的位圖數(shù)組。

然后我們定義樹的字符。

按鈕 Enter 和 Select 的定義。

常數(shù)

寫你名字的字母字符串。

變量

首先初始化 LCD。然后創(chuàng)建特殊字符恐龍字符和樹字符。

主循環(huán)功能,從清除 LCD 開始。

手柄菜單功能

從兩個按鈕讀取。引腳模式為內(nèi)部上拉,使用內(nèi)部上拉電阻。

?菜單和功能

菜單開始和得分。

然后我們打印菜單并使用數(shù)字讀取功能讀取按鈕。

打印分?jǐn)?shù)功能在 LCD 上打印分?jǐn)?shù)。

開始游戲功能

現(xiàn)在,我們需要使用此代碼在 Tinkercad 環(huán)境中對 Arduino UNO 板進行編程以開始執(zhí)行它。

在右上角的代碼選項卡上,單擊下拉菜單并僅選擇文本。當(dāng)系統(tǒng)提示您要刪除所有 Blocks 時,請單擊 Continue。

然后將上面的代碼粘貼到軟件表中。

現(xiàn)在,您已準(zhǔn)備好開始執(zhí)行電路。

TRexCode.ino

第 3 步:Tinkercad 模擬

現(xiàn)在,單擊 Start Simulation 按鈕開始模擬。

您會看到Arduino已連接到屏幕上的 USB 端口,這表明它已通電并開始執(zhí)行軟件。

如果正確執(zhí)行了所有步驟,則 LCD 會亮起并開始游戲。

恭喜,您剛剛構(gòu)建了 Arduino 電路,可以在 Tinkercad 上播放您最喜歡的動畫音調(diào)。

然后你可以開始游戲模擬,你可以像在真實電路中一樣玩那個游戲。

現(xiàn)在您可以使用真實組件構(gòu)建電路。

在這里您可以找到 Tinkercad Simulation,您可以在其中查看電路連接和代碼。您還可以編輯所有連接和代碼。

?


下載該資料的人也在下載 下載該資料的人還在閱讀
更多 >

評論

查看更多

下載排行

本周

  1. 1無鉛焊接的可靠性
  2. 1.03 MB   |  5次下載  |  1 積分
  3. 2GBT1094.11-2022電力變壓器第11部分:干式變壓器
  4. 14.12 MB   |  3次下載  |  免費
  5. 3PT500齒輪傳動動力學(xué)綜合測試實驗臺
  6. 0.16 MB   |  3次下載  |  免費
  7. 4爬電距離和電氣間隙計算
  8. 0.75 MB   |  2次下載  |  1 積分
  9. 5SX1308應(yīng)用電路圖與SX1308升壓電路圖
  10. 0.18 MB   |  1次下載  |  免費
  11. 6ADC參數(shù)單位換算
  12. 761.94KB   |  1次下載  |  免費
  13. 7串口工具UartAssist5.0.exe
  14. 0.60 MB   |  1次下載  |  免費
  15. 8UCC38C42 25瓦自諧振復(fù)位正激變換器
  16. 320.6KB   |  1次下載  |  免費

本月

  1. 1ACDC變換器的原理圖免費下載
  2. 0.26 MB   |  65次下載  |  免費
  3. 2無刷電機控制方案設(shè)計合作
  4. 1.05 MB   |  22次下載  |  免費
  5. 3美的超薄電磁爐TM-S1-09B主板原理圖
  6. 0.08 MB   |  20次下載  |  免費
  7. 4純電動汽?的主要部件及?作原理
  8. 5.76 MB   |  12次下載  |  5 積分
  9. 5GP328和GP88S對講機的維修實列資料合集免費下載
  10. 0.03 MB   |  10次下載  |  10 積分
  11. 6舒爾SLX4無線話筒接收機原理圖:二次變頻超外差部分
  12. 0.27 MB   |  8次下載  |  免費
  13. 7IP5385_DEMO開發(fā)資料
  14. 1.96 MB   |  7次下載  |  2 積分
  15. 8i.MX Linux開發(fā)實戰(zhàn)指南—基于野火i.MX系列開發(fā)板
  16. 17.86 MB   |  7次下載  |  免費

總榜

  1. 1matlab軟件下載入口
  2. 未知  |  935115次下載  |  10 積分
  3. 2開源硬件-PMP21529.1-4 開關(guān)降壓/升壓雙向直流/直流轉(zhuǎn)換器 PCB layout 設(shè)計
  4. 1.48MB  |  420061次下載  |  10 積分
  5. 3Altium DXP2002下載入口
  6. 未知  |  233084次下載  |  10 積分
  7. 4電路仿真軟件multisim 10.0免費下載
  8. 340992  |  191363次下載  |  10 積分
  9. 5十天學(xué)會AVR單片機與C語言視頻教程 下載
  10. 158M  |  183329次下載  |  10 積分
  11. 6labview8.5下載
  12. 未知  |  81581次下載  |  10 積分
  13. 7Keil工具MDK-Arm免費下載
  14. 0.02 MB  |  73805次下載  |  10 積分
  15. 8LabVIEW 8.6下載
  16. 未知  |  65985次下載  |  10 積分